Plant details
Small mound-forming hebes tend to be hardier than larger varieties, and make very attractive neat plants for edging or containers. Emerald Green', previously called 'Green Globe', rarely flowers but makes an excellent container plant as the leaf colour is stunning. It has small, emerald green leaves and a round, ball-shape habit. Trim plants in spring to maintain the shape. It can also be used in rockeries to offset bright alpines or in the front of a garden border.
Family: Scrophulariaceae
Genus: Hebe
Cultivar: Emerald Green
Plant type: Evergreen shrub
Flower colour: White
Foliage colour: Dark green
Sun exposure: Full sun, Partial shade
Soil: Well-drained/light, Clay/heavy, Acidic, Chalky/alkaline
Hardiness: Hardy
Skill level: Beginner
Height: 40cm
Spread: 40cm
Time to take cuttings: June to August
